3v4l.org

run code in 300+ PHP versions simultaneously
<?php if(@print Hello and print chr(44) and print chr(32) and @print World and print chr(33) ){} /*if (print chr(72)) if (print chr(101)) if (print chr(108)) if (print chr(111)) if (print chr(44)) if (print chr(32)) if (print chr(87)) if (print chr(111)) if (print chr(114)) if (print chr(108)) if (print chr(100)) if (print chr(33)) { }*/
Finding entry points
Branch analysis from position: 0
2 jumps found. (Code = 43) Position 1 = 12, Position 2 = 12
Branch analysis from position: 12
1 jumps found. (Code = 62) Position 1 = -2
Branch analysis from position: 12
filename:       /in/VaKW6
function name:  (null)
number of ops:  13
compiled vars:  none
line      #* E I O op                           fetch          ext  return  operands
-------------------------------------------------------------------------------------
    2     0  E >   BEGIN_SILENCE                                    ~0      
          1        FETCH_CONSTANT                                   ~1      'Hello'
          2        ECHO                                                     ~1
          3        END_SILENCE                                              ~0
    3     4        ECHO                                                     '%2C'
    4     5        ECHO                                                     '+'
    5     6        BEGIN_SILENCE                                    ~2      
          7        FETCH_CONSTANT                                   ~3      'World'
          8        ECHO                                                     ~3
          9        END_SILENCE                                              ~2
    6    10        ECHO                                                     '%21'
         11      > JMPZ                                                     <true>, ->12
   21    12    > > RETURN                                                   1

Generated using Vulcan Logic Dumper, using php 8.0.0


preferences:
161.95 ms | 1393 KiB | 13 Q